Tronda USDT o'tkazmalarini qanday avtomatlashtirish mumkin: to'lovlar, depozitlar va keng ko'lamli komissiyalarni boshqarish
Siz platformani yaratdingiz. Foydalanuvchilar USDT depozitlarini qo'yadilar. Siz ushbu depozitlarni xazinaga o'tkazishingiz, yuzlab manzillarga to'lovlarni qayta ishlashingiz va bularning barchasini TRX modadan chiqib ketayotgandek yondirmasdan bajarishingiz kerak. Men jamoalarning aynan shu sikldan o'tishini ko'rdim: avval ular hamma narsani qattiq kodlashadi, keyin TRX to'lovlari o'zlarining foyda va zararlariga ta'sir qiladi, keyin esa ular bu voqeadan keyin energiya boshqaruvini qo'shishga shoshilishadi. Ushbu qo'llanma "birinchi marta to'g'ri bajaring" versiyasi bo'lib, depozit yig'ish, partiyaviy to'lovlar, infratuzilma sifatida energiya va ishlab chiqarish trafikidan omon qolgan TronWeb naqshlarini qamrab oladi.
Tizim arxitekturasi: Siz aslida nimani qurmoqdasiz
Trondagi har bir USDT platformasida uchta asosiy oqim mavjud: pul keladi (depozitlar), pul ketadi (to'lovlar) va resurslar boshqariladi (Energiya/TRX). Ko'pgina jamoalar dastlabki ikkitasini to'g'ri bajaradilar va uchinchisini butunlay e'tiborsiz qoldiradilar - keyin nima uchun ularning operatsion xarajatlari kerak bo'lganidan 2-3 baravar ko'p ekanligiga hayron bo'lishadi.
Ishlab chiqarishda ishlaydigan arxitektura:
DEPOZIT MONITORI
TRC-20 ni kuzatib boradi. Noyob depozit manzillari bo'yicha hodisalarni o'tkazadi. Kiruvchi USDT ni aniqlaydi, chegaraga nisbatan tasdiqlaydi (odatda 1-3 blok) va foydalanuvchining ichki balansini kreditlaydi.
SUVURISH DVIGATELI
Depozit qilingan USDTni individual depozit manzillaridan markazlashtirilgan g'aznachilik hamyoniga o'tkazadi. Har bir depozit manzili uchun energiya talab qilinadi — aksariyat jamoalar aynan shu yerda muammolarga duch kelishadi.
TO'LOV PROTSESSORI
Gʻaznachilik hamyonidan pul yechib olish soʻrovlarini qayta ishlaydi. TRC-20 oʻtkazma operatsiyalarini uzatadi, tasdiqlarni kuzatib boradi va ichki daftarni yangilaydi.
ENERGIYA MENEJERI
Har bir chiquvchi tranzaksiya (sweep yoki to'lov) efirga uzatishdan oldin yetarli energiyaga ega bo'lishini ta'minlaydi. O'z-o'zini boshqarish, delegatsiya xizmati API yoki gibrid yondashuv orqali delegatsiyalarni amalga oshiradi.
Energiya menejeri ko'pchilik jamoalar oxirgi qo'shadigan komponentdir. Bu siz birinchi bo'lib loyihalashtirgan narsa bo'lishi kerak - chunki u har bir tranzaksiya narxini, tozalash ishonchliligini va foydalanuvchilaringiz "iltimos, TRX yuboring" xabarini ko'rish-ko'rmasligini (ular ko'rmasligi kerak) belgilaydi.
Avtomatlashtirilgan depozit yig'ish
Eng toza yondashuv: har bir foydalanuvchi (yoki har bir hisob-faktura) uchun noyob Tron manzilini yaratish. USDT ushbu manzilga yetib kelganida, monitoringiz TRC-20 o'tkazmasi hodisasini aniqlaydi, uni tasdiqlaydi, foydalanuvchiga kredit beradi va xazinaga supurishni navbatga qo'yadi.
Energiya muhim bo'lgan joy - bu tozalash. Har bir depozit manzili sizning xazinangizga chiquvchi USDT o'tkazmasini amalga oshirish uchun Energiyaga muhtoj. Agar depozit manzilida nol TRX va nol Energiya bo'lsa, tozalash muvaffaqiyatsiz tugaydi. Foydalanuvchingiz "depozit qilingan" ni ko'radi, lekin mablag'lar aslida sizning xazinangizda emas.
Foydalanuvchingizdan hech qachon TRX yuborishni so'ramang. Hech qachon. Foydalanuvchi USDT depozit qiladi. Sizning tizimingiz qolgan hamma narsani hal qiladi. Agar supurish energiyaga muhtoj bo'lsa, sizning infratuzilmangiz uni ta'minlaydi — depozit manzillarini TRX bilan oldindan moliyalashtirish, energiyani talab bo'yicha topshirish yoki gibrid yondashuvdan foydalanish orqali. Foydalanuvchi tajribasi quyidagicha bo'lishi kerak: USDT yuboring, qoldiqni ko'ring, bajarildi.
Tozalash uchun energiya: Har bir tozalashdan oldin, tizimingiz depozit manzilining energiya balansini tronWeb.trx.getAccountResources(address) orqali tekshiradi. Agar yetarli bo'lmasa, energiya delegatsiyasini ishga tushiring (depozit manzilidan TronNRG ga 4 ta TRX yuboring yoki o'zingizning qo'shilgan pulingizdan foydalaning). Tasdiqlashni kuting, so'ngra tozalashni amalga oshiring. Parvozdan oldingi + tozalash siklining barchasi ~6 soniya davom etadi.
To'plamli to'lov tizimlari
To'lovlar arxitektura jihatidan sodda (bitta xazina hamyoni ko'plab oluvchilarga yuboriladi), lekin noto'g'ri bajarilsa, xavfliroq. Ikkita muhim naqsh:
Idempotent ishlov berish: Har bir to'lov so'rovi noyob identifikatorga ega bo'ladi. Translyatsiya qilishdan oldin, ushbu identifikator allaqachon qayta ishlanganligini tekshiring. Agar ha bo'lsa, mavjud tranzaksiya xeshini qaytaring. Agar yo'q bo'lsa, translyatsiya qiling va yozib oling. Bu qayta urinishlar, veb-huklarning takrorlanishi yoki operator xatolari tufayli ikki marta to'lovlarning oldini oladi. Bu aniq eshitiladi. Men uchta platformaning buni qimmat usulda o'rganganini ko'rdim.
Tasdiqlash bilan ketma-ket translyatsiya: Bir vaqtning o'zida 100 ta to'lovni translyatsiya qilmang. Tronning nonce tizimi Ethereumniki kabi ishlamaydi. Buning o'rniga, ketma-ket translyatsiya qiling: 1-tranzaksiyani yuboring, tasdiqni kuting (3 soniya), nonceni yangilang, 2-tranzaksiyani yuboring. Yuqori o'tkazuvchanlik uchun bir nechta issiq hamyonlardan foydalaning va to'lovlarni ular bo'ylab taqsimlang.
| Partiya hajmi | Ketma-ket (1 ta hamyon) | Parallel (4 ta hamyon) | Energiya narxi (TronNRG) |
|---|---|---|---|
| 10 ta to'lov | ~30 soniya | ~8 soniya | 40 TRX (12 dollar) |
| 100 ta to'lov | ~5 daqiqa | ~1,5 daqiqa | 400 TRX (120 dollar) |
| 1000 ta to'lov | ~50 daqiqa | ~13 daqiqa | 4000 TRX (1200 dollar) |
Energiya infratuzilma sifatida (keyinchalik emas)
Mana men qayta-qayta ko'rib turgan xato: bir jamoa chiroyli to'lov tizimini yaratadi, uni ishga tushiradi va keyin hech kim energiya haqida o'ylamagani uchun har bir o'tkazma 7-9 TRX sarflayotganini aniqlaydi. Kuniga 100 ta o'tkazma bilan bu kuniga 210-270 dollardan qochish mumkin bo'lgan xarajatlarni anglatadi. 1000 ta o'tkazma bilan bu kuniga 2100-2700 dollarni tashkil etadi.
Energiya sizning arxitekturangizning birinchi darajali komponenti bo'lishi kerak. Murakkablik tartibida uchta yondashuv:
Delegatsiya xizmati (eng oddiy): Har bir to'lov yoki supurishdan oldin, jo'natuvchi hamyondan TronNRG ga 4 ta TRX yuboring. Energiya ~3 soniyada yetib keladi. Keyin USDT o'tkazmasini uzating. Tizimingiz har bir tranzaksiyaga bitta API chaqiruvi va 3 soniya kutish vaqtini qo'shadi. Narxi: har bir o'tkazma uchun 4 ta TRX, kapitalni blokirovka qilish nolga teng. Bu sezilarli o'tkazma ta'sirisiz ~500 tagacha kunlik o'tkazmalar uchun ishlaydi.
O'z-o'zini steyking (har bir o'tkazma uchun eng arzon): O'zingizning energiyangizni yaratish uchun TRXni muzlatib qo'ying. Har bir tranzaksiyadan oldin steyking hamyoningizdan har bir jo'natuvchi hamyonga delegat qiling. Narxi: har bir o'tkazma uchun deyarli nolga teng, lekin har bir kunlik o'tkazma uchun ~95,000 TRX talab qilinadi (joriy narxlarda ~28,000 dollar). TronWeb quyidagilarni chaqiradi: freezeBalanceV2 va delegateResource .
Gibrid (ishlab chiqarishning eng yaxshi nuqtasi): O'rtacha kunlik hajmingizning 80% uchun yetarli TRX tiking. Qolgan 20% uchun (cho'qqilar, portlash trafik) delegatsiyadan foydalaning. Tizimingiz har bir yuborishdan oldin mavjud energiyani tekshiradi — agar tikishdan yetarli bo'lsa, to'g'ridan-to'g'ri yuboring. Agar yetarli bo'lmasa, delegatsiyani ishga tushiring. Bu sizga delegatsiyaning portlash sig'imi bilan tikishning past bazaviy narxini beradi.
TronWeb ishlab chiqarish naqshlari
TronWeb SDK (Node.js) dasturiy Tron o'zaro ta'siri uchun standart hisoblanadi. Ishlab chiqarishda saqlanib qolgan naqshlar:
Parvozdan oldingi energiya tekshiruvi: Har bir USDT jo'natmasidan oldin getAccountResources() ga qo'ng'iroq qiling va EnergyLimit - EnergyUsed >= 65000 tekshiring. Agar yetarli bo'lmasa, Energy kelguncha delegatsiyani ishga tushiring va so'rovnoma o'tkazing (500ms intervallar, 30 soniyali tanaffus).
Xavfsizlik bo'yicha komissiya limiti: Tranzaksiyalaringizga har doim feeLimit o'rnating. Bu biror narsa noto'g'ri bo'lsa, yoqib yuborilishi mumkin bo'lgan maksimal TRX ni cheklaydi. USDT o'tkazmalari uchun o'rtacha limit 15-20 TRX ni tashkil qiladi — hatto energiyasiz ham o'tkazmani qoplash uchun yetarli, ammo xato hamyoningizni bo'shatmasligi uchun cheklangan.
Tasdiqlash tekshiruvi: Translyatsiyadan so'ng, kvitansiya bilan natijani olmaguningizcha getTransactionInfo(txHash) so'rovini o'tkazing. receipt.result === 'SUCCESS' ni tekshiring. Faqat translyatsiya javobiga ishonmang — bu faqat tranzaksiya mempulga qabul qilinganligini tasdiqlaydi, zanjirda muvaffaqiyatli bo'lganligini emas.
Xatolarni boshqarish: Eng keng tarqalgan xatoliklar: OUT_OF_ENERGY (Energiya va TRX yetarli emas), REVERT (shartnoma darajasidagi xato — odatda USDT balansi yetarli emas) va BANDWIDTH_ERROR (O'tkazish qobiliyati yo'q — kam uchraydi, odatda hisobni faollashtirish kerakligini anglatadi). Ularning har biri turli xil tiklash mantig'ini talab qiladi.
Keng ko'lamli iqtisodiyot
| Kunlik hajm | Burn TRX (Energiyasiz) | TronNRG delegatsiyasi | Saqlash |
|---|---|---|---|
| 100 ta transfer | Kuniga 210-270 dollar | Kuniga 120 dollar | Kuniga 90-150 dollar |
| 500 ta transfer | Kuniga $1,050-1,350 | Kuniga 600 dollar | Kuniga 450-750 dollar |
| 1000 ta transfer | Kuniga 2100-2700 dollar | Kuniga 1200 dollar | Kuniga 900-1500 dollar |
| 5000 ta transfer | Kuniga $10,500-13,500 | Kuniga 6000 dollar | Kuniga 4500-7500 dollar |
Kuniga 1000 ta o'tkazma amalga oshirilganda, delegatsiya biznesingizga yiliga 328 500-547 500 dollar tejashga yordam beradi. Bu yaxlitlash xatosi emas — bu rentabellikka ta'sir qiluvchi qator elementi. Va amalga oshirish qiymati har bir tranzaksiya uchun bitta qo'shimcha API chaqiruvidir.
Kuniga 2000 tadan ortiq o'tkazmalar uchun gibrid yondashuv (o'z-o'zini boshqarish + burstlar uchun delegatsiya) iqtisodiy jihatdan mantiqiy bo'lib qoladi. Undan pastroqda, sof delegatsiya sodda va kapitalni bog'lamaydi. Staking zararsizligi kalkulyatorida o'zingizning aniq hajmingiz bilan raqamlarni hisoblang.
Telegramda TronNRG bilan bog'laning →
Shuningdek o'qing: Dasturchilar uchun Tron Energy API · Bizneslar uchun avtomatlashtirilgan delegatsiya · P2P ish stolini qanday boshqarish kerak
SIZNING INFRASTRUKTURANGIZ. BIZNING ENERGIYAMIZ. HAR BIR O'TKAZISH UCHUN $1.20.
TronNRG delegatsiyasi bitta API chaqiruviga integratsiya qilinadi. Har bir o'tkazma uchun 4 ta TRX. 3 soniyada yetkazib berish. Korxona SLAlari mavjud.
TRONNRG ni INTEGRATSIYA QILING →